Kuidas luua veebisaiti nullist: kuus asja, mida tuleks mõelda

Sõltumata sellest, kas kasutate veebisaiti turunduse, müügi või klienditeeninduse jaoks, on see teie klientide ja äripartnerite jaoks digitaalne show. Veebisaidid on ennast meie digitaalses maailmas sisse seadnud ja on tänapäeval üks kõige põhilisemaid turundus- ja müügivahendeid Internetis.

Selles juhendis, kuidas veebisaiti nullist üles ehitada, läheme üle kuue etapi ilusa veebisaidi loomiseks. See ei saa aga olema lihtne, kuna nii hirmutav kui veebisaidi loomine nõuab teatavaid kodeerimise teadmisi.

Kuni olete seda vähemalt osaliselt katnud, anname teile valdkonnad, mida peaksite oma veebilehe kujundamisel hoolitsema. Veebisaite on siiski keeruline üles ehitada ja me ei soovitaks seda kõigile.

Enne meie näpunäidete tutvumist räägime õige platvormi valimisest.

Platvormi valimine

Veebisaidi loomiseks on palju võimalusi. Saate kasutada veebisaitide ehitajaid, sisuhaldussüsteeme või ise luua.

Wix (lugege meie Wixi arvustust), Squarespace (lugege meie Squarespace Reviewt) ja Weebly (lugege meie Weebly arvustust) on parimate veebisaitide koostajate hulgas ja pakuvad head alternatiivi nullist ehitamiseks, eriti kui te ei tea, kuidas koodi kodeerida.

Wixi toimetaja

Teisest küljest on veebisaidi koostaja mittekasutamisel mitmeid eeliseid. Võib-olla teile mallid ei meeldi, olete laadimisaegadega rahul või arvate, et Wix ja ettevõte on liiga kallid. Sel juhul võite ikkagi tugineda sisuhaldussüsteemidele nagu WordPress. Altpoolt leiate meie kolm juhendit selle kasutamiseks.

  • WordPressi kasutamise juhend algajatele
  • Vahepealne juhend WordPressi kasutamiseks
  • WordPressi kasutamise üksikasjalik juhend

Sisuhaldussüsteemide probleem on aga see, et need vajavad koolituse aega ja pakuvad piiratud funktsionaalsust. Rääkimata pluginitisest, mille all WordPress kannatab. Ilma pistikprogrammideta pole WordPress kasulik. Lisaks olete teiste arendajate meelevallas, sest iga värskenduse väljaandmisel võivad teie veebisaidi funktsioonid töötamast lakkida.

Kuid kui te ei tunne pikselihutusega tegelemist ja tahate asju enda kätte võtta, siis on see artikkel teile sobiv. Näitame teile peamisi aspekte, mida peaksite veebisaidi loomisel nullist arvestama, nii et alustame.

Nõuded ja mustand

Hea tarkvarainsener alustab alati mustandiga. Iga mustand peaks kajastama teie, teie klientide ja teiste sidusrühmade nõudeid. Õigeks saamiseks peate oma disaini keskenduma sellistele asjadele nagu funktsioonid, töökindlus, kohanemisvõime (kuna nõuded muutuvad aja jooksul) ja turvalisus.

Kõige kriitilisem on kohanemisvõime, kuna peate veenduma, et teie tarkvara on ehitatud nii, et seda saaks hiljem laiendada või muuta.

Üks näpunäide on enne programmeerimise alustamist nõuete loendisse kirjutamine. Sellest loendist ja struktuuri visandist saab teie majakas ja see aitab teid kursis hoida.

Nüüd, kui teate, millised nõuded teie veebisaidile kehtivad, on järgmine samm tehnoloogiliste otsuste tegemine. Programmeerimiskeeli on palju, tuhandete raamistikega on loodud arendajate elu lihtsamaks. Kui soovite veebisaiti luua, siis vaevalt suudate JavaScripti ja PHP-d vältida.

Praegu peaksite teadma, et HTML ja CSS ei ole programmeerimiskeeled, nii et te pole kodeerija ainult seetõttu, et tunnete neid.

Need on märgistuskeeled, mis on mõeldud konteksti lisamiseks muudele protsessidele.

Saidi struktuur

Saidi struktuur ja teabearhitektuur on hea veebisaidi olulised aspektid. Mõelge nüüd, kuidas soovite, et kasutajad navigeeriksid ja kuidas tuleks sisu neile esitada.

Algajad valivad sageli ühelehelise paigutuse, mis tähendab veebisaiti, millel pole alamlehti. Kujundus on eriti kasulik lihtsate veebisaitide jaoks, kus on ainult nende kohta teavet. Keerukamate jaoks soovitame mitmeleheküljelist kontseptsiooni. Kui soovite üles ehitada lihtsa sihtlehe, vaadake meie juhendit Instapage’i kasutamise kohta.

Üks asi, mida peaksite teadma: keerukas navigeerimine, kus on palju linke ja alamstruktuure, toob kaasa kõrgemad otsimootori optimeerimise nõuded.

Kasutajaliides / kasutaja kogemus

Nüüd, kui planeerimine on tehtud, räägime ühe veebisaidi loomise kõige olulisemast aspektist: kujundusest. Pole tähtis, kui vinge on teie andmebaas või kui geniaalne on teie serveri marsruutimine – kasutaja hoolib ainult kasutajaliidesest.

Hea kasutatavus sisaldab paljusid osi. Peate arvestama laadimisaegade, värvide, fondide ja isegi kasutajapsühholoogiaga ning väljendama neid järjepidevas ja hästi läbimõeldud kontseptsioonis. Kui teie veebisaidi laadimisajad on halvad, lugege meie artiklit veebisaidi laadimisaegade parandamise kohta.

Kasutajaliides on nagu nali. Kui peate seda seletama, pole see nii hea.

Teie veebisaiti peab olema lihtne kasutada, see peab hea välja nägema ja pakkuma kõiki funktsioone, mida kasutaja soovib, ilma et see näib ülekoormatud. Mõelge, kuidas saate neid kõige kasutajasõbralikumal viisil esitada ja looge alati kaadriraami.

Vastuvõtlik disain

Kujutage ette, et investeerite tunde ilusa veebisaidi loomiseks. Pärast selle valmimist soovite seda oma sõbrale näidata. Ta avab selle oma nutitelefonis ja ütleb: “Noh, see näeb välja nagu jama.” See võib olla üsna pettumust valmistav ja teiega võib juhtuda, kui loote oma veebisaidi reageerivale kujundusele tähelepanu pööramata.

Suurem osa Interneti kasutamisest toimub mobiilseadmete kaudu. Pole vahet, kas tegemist on nutitelefoni või tahvelarvutiga, eelistame surfata mobiilis.

Sellepärast peaksite mõtlema, kuidas teie veebisait mobiilseadmetes välja näeb. Tehnilisel tasandil peate pildi ja fondi suuruse skaleerima sõltuvalt ekraani eraldusvõimest, kohandama elementide positsioneerimist ja võib-olla isegi navigeerimise kontseptsiooni muutma. Praktiliselt ehitate teist veebisaiti.

Adami ja Eevaga alustamise vältimiseks peaksite kasutama reageerivaid raamistikke. Lisaks Bootstrapile ja Sihtasutusele on veel sadu, kui mitte tuhandeid. Mõelge hoolikalt, millist raamistikku kavatsete kasutada. Vale valik võib hiljem meelt tehes põhjustada palju tööd.

Raamide valimiseks on palju põhjuseid. Need on korduvkasutatavad komponendid, mis pakuvad head viisi funktsioonide lisamiseks oma rakendusele, ilma et peaksite neid ise ehitama. Lisaks on nad spetsialistide poolt testitud ja tõestatud.

Lisaks sellele, et peate õppima raamistiku kasutamist, on selle kasutamisel veel üks probleem. Võib-olla ei pea te ise raamistikku testima, kuid peaksite siiski nägema, kuidas see ülejäänud teie koodiga käitub. Raamistiku rakendamine võib kiiresti põhjustada vigu ja vigu, eriti kui kasutate mitut.

Vead ja testimine

Vead või need, mida meie arendajad nimetavad „dokumenteerimata funktsioonideks”, on vead, mis tekivad siis, kui rakendus ei tee seda, mida soovite. Vea ilmnemise põhjus pole tingimata teie või teie kirjutatud kood. Neid võib juhtuda lugematul hulgal. Sellepärast on nende parandamiseks vaja palju distsipliini ja enesekontrolli.

Enne vea parandamist peate siiski teadma, et see on olemas. Tarkvaraarenduses kasutame tööriistu, mis hõlbustavad automaatset silumist. Lisaks integratsiooniserveritele, näiteks Jenkinsile, peaksite looma automaatse testimise raamistiku.

Kui olete kooditüki kirjutanud, peaksite alati kirjutama ka testkoodi, mis hindab funktsiooni käitumist. See tagab kõigi funktsioonide toimimise üksteisest sõltumatult.

Iga kord, kui lisate veadeni viiva koodi, märkate vead ja isegi neid põhjustanud koodi, kuna seotud testid ebaõnnestuvad, mis võimaldab teil luua keerukamaid ja kvaliteetsemaid rakendusi.

Hostimine ja turvalisus

Pärast oma veebisaidi kujundamist ja ülesehitamist soovite selle mingil hetkel veebis üles panna. Kui teil pole keldris serverit, kasutate tõenäoliselt veebimajutajat. Kui soovite endiselt seda ise hostida, mida te tõenäoliselt ei peaks, siis lugege meie artiklit oma veebisaidi hostimise kohta.

Majutuse pakkujatel on siiski palju pakkuda. SiteGround (lugege meie SiteGround ülevaadet) jms on oma ala eksperdid. Lisaks hostimisele pakuvad nad palju turvateenuseid nagu SSL / TLS krüptimine, pahavara eemaldamine, tulemüürid ja DDoS-kaitse. Kui see kõik oli teile kreeka keeles, lugege meie veebisaidi turvalisuse juhendit.

SiteGround on suurepärane valik, kuid see oli meie parima veebimajutusteenuse pakkujate artikli teisel kohal. HostGator on meie esimene valik. Sellel pole kiireid kiirusi – selleks vajate Kinstat -, kuid see sisaldab palju funktsioone ja plaani peaaegu iga eelarve jaoks. Lisateavet saate meie HostGatori arvustuse kohta.

Seadistamine, installimine, hostimine, koorma tasakaalustamine, varundamine ja avariitaaste, tulemüürid ja turvalisus on kõik asjad, mida saate vaid 5–10 dollari eest kuus.

Lõplikud mõtted

Nagu näete, pole veebisaidi nullist üles ehitamine nii lihtne. Kogu protsess on keeruline, ehkki me ei hõlmanud selles juhendis paljusid olulisi osi, näiteks brauseriteülest ühilduvust, SEO-d või skaleeritavust.

Võõra inimesena teete kiiresti vigu ja raiskate palju aega ja raha. Kui teil pole veel HTMLi, CSSi ja JavaScriptiga kogemusi, peaksite WordPressi parima veebimajutuse jaoks kasutama meie veebisaidi koostajat või WordPressit.

Te ei ehita autot ise, kui soovite, ostate selle spetsialistidelt. Sama peaksite tegema ka veebisaitidega. Kui soovite selle siiski nullist üles ehitada, tehke kas või arvutiteaduse kursus või kasutage veebisaidi koostajat.

Kas kavatsete oma veebisaiti ikka nullist üles ehitada? Miks te ei soovi veebisaidi koostajat kasutada? Andke meile allpool kommentaarides teada ja tänan lugemise eest.

Kim Martin
Kim Martin Administrator
Sorry! The Author has not filled his profile.
follow me